Jealous Fork is a restaurant serving up new American cuisine. They are famous for their innovation, creativity, and unique take on classical American dishes. Featured on the Food Network for their artisan pancakes, Jealous Fork offers diners something truly unique and special. Head to this eatery to explore a variety of menu items that will tantalize your taste buds.

Alejandro Dalmau
I’m literally still sitting at the table as I write this. We just ordered with Miranda, who was warm, sharp, and genuinely welcoming. Then Joaquin, the chef and owner, stopped by our table and had a really pleasant, unforced conversation with us. No sales pitch, no ego, just pride and care.

And here’s the thing, the food hadn’t even arrived yet when I was already impressed.

You can tell right away when a place is being run by people who actually care. The staff, the energy, the location, everything feels intentional and well thought out. Jealous Fork earned real credit before a single plate hit the table.

We started with the burrata, simple yet sophisticated and a perfect way to begin. Clean flavors, nothing trying too hard, just done right.

Next was the steak sandwich on their house made ciabatta. This is worth mentioning because I’ve had ciabatta that’s so crunchy it hurts your teeth. This wasn’t that at all. The bread was soft and pillowy, still doughy in the middle, with horseradish and cheddar that didn’t overpower anything. Even the steak itself was impressively tender for how thick it was.

I finished with a chocolate chip pancake, which was an excellent way to end the meal. Comforting, satisfying, and exactly what you want it to be.

We also had a banana matcha latte, which honestly surprised me in the best way. Balanced, flavorful, and not gimmicky.

I really can’t wait to come back. This place is doing things the right way.
